He does not know his way around and accidentally leads Billy and Edgar … Web2 days ago · Since 2024, the U.S. Department of Labor (DOL) has seen a 69 percent increase in children being employed illegally by companies. In the last fiscal year, the department found 835 companies it investigated had employed more than 3,800 children in violation of the Fair Labor Standards Act.
